![]() 2-3 seems to grind on me, even if the clutch is in.. Nothing audible, but I can feel the jaring coming up the shifter. I have a very late build 2010.. Something like 3/10 or 4/10.. So, I don't have the output shaft issue.. But, notchy gears are a definite yes. I do drive the piss out of mine on the track as well.. I no-lift-shift it every time under full boost and throttle.. Drive line is very clunky when using clutch, even shifting gears makes a clunk.. Mine is much more noticeable now that I have all the HD bushings and such.. It's to be expected, but even I never realized how noisy the driveline was. |

I use RP; the notchiness is 2>3 and seems to lessen once the Tranny is warmed up. I don't know that RP makes much of a difference, but warming up the Tranny does.
When the Tranny is cold, I pause when shifting; but it is still notchy sometimes. I also shift 1>3>5 in City Traffic, revving to 2000~2300 RPM I have a 2012 Challenger with the same TR6060; 900 miles now and haven't really noticed the same 2>3 notchiness as in my 2010 Camaro. |

Anyone that isn't experiencing the problem are not driving the car aggressively. I can produce the problem easily by simply shifting at high RPM's or speed shifting. For me it happens mostly 2-3, as I don't rev too hard in 1st (too much torque to deal with). So, in 2nd. I'll get it up to 4.5+k/rpm for example and then slam it into 3rd., and it won't go into gear, I have to let off accelerator to get rpms down, then it will go into gear. |

The factory hurst in the camaro is definitely notchy compared to a 2012 challenger no doubt. But the CTS-V, GT500, Corvette, and Challenger forums all show far fewer synchro issues with the 2012's over previous years so SOMETHING changed in the TR6060 over time. Again, the majority of complaints here seem to be from 2010 owners.
